Custom build project from the frame up: started in January of 2007 and still a work in progress. 

  • 80 cubic inch Evo motor rebuild and polished,  
  • clean running does not need to wrench on, 
  • 250 Avon rear tire, 
  • springer front end, 
  • jockey shift 5 speed transmission,
  • into 1 exhaust, 
  • hand made tank, seat, and, ear fender, 
  • hydraulic forward controls. 

This bike was finished by 2 Michigan Biker Build off Winners. Just a cool bike to show up on, yet a solid piece of machinery.

Orange County Choppers goes electric

Thu, 13 Aug 2009

The video you're watching isn't the electric chopper built by Orange County Choppers, but Paul Teutal Sr. has been showing off the Siemens Smart Chopper that he did build, a chopper built for Siemens to display their technical prowess. According to Teutal Sr., the Smart Chopper has a range of around 60 miles and can do up to 100mph.
